Troodos wines, a renowned wine region located on the island of Cyprus, benefit from the protected designation of origin (PDO), which guarantees their authenticity and quality. Nestled in the Troodos mountain range, this region offers an exceptional terroir, characterised by diverse soils and a Mediterranean climate ideal for viticulture. The vineyards are planted at altitudes reaching up to 1,500 metres, promoting a slow and balanced ripening of the grapes.
Troodos wines present a varied range, including powerful and aromatic reds, fresh and mineral whites, as well as elegant and fruity rosés. Among the flagship grape varieties of the appellation are Maratheftiko, Xynisteri, and Giannoudi, which fully express the unique characteristics of the Cypriot terroir.
